Servings: 2

Preparation duration: 15 minutes

Cooking duration: 15 minutes

 

Ingredients:

1/4 cup chopped broccoli

1 tablespoon butter

1/4 cup chopped carrot

1 cup cold cooked rice

1 egg, beaten

1/8 teaspoon garlic powder

1 green onion, chopped

1/8 teaspoon ground ginger

1/4 cup frozen peas

1 (6 ounce) boneless pork loin chop, cut into small pieces

4 1/2 teaspoons soy sauce

Equipment:

frying pan

bowl

Cooking instruction summary:

Melt butter in a large non-stick skillet over medium heat. Cook and stir pork, carrot, broccoli, and green onion in melted butter until pork is cooked through, 7 to 10 minutes. Remove pork mixture to a bowl and return skillet to medium heat. Scramble egg in the skillet until completely set. Return the pork mixture to the skillet. Stir rice, soy sauce, garlic powder, and ground ginger into the pork mixture; cook and stir until heated through, 7 to 10 minutes. Kitchen-Friendly View
